Washington, to assist foster healthy and balanced dirt, planted a lot of rye as a cover plant. Rye wasn't high on the checklist of scrumptious, edible grains, however Anderson didn't think it must go to wasteinstead, he desired to turn it into bourbon. Cocktail Bar. Washington was, at first, hesitant to delve into a brand-new company ventureafter all, at 65 years old, he had actually wanted to invest his retired years in loved one tranquility, yet after hearing Anderson's proposition, along with referring a buddy who was entailed in the rum company, Washington acquiesced
When Washington died in 1799, he left the distillery to his nephew Lawrence Lewis, that did not have the wise business mind of Washington. Lewis wasn't nearly as effective in the distilling organization, and basics when a fire melted the distillery to the ground in 1814, it wasn't reconstructed. The state of Virginia purchased the website in the early 1930s, and planned to rebuild the distillery, but just took care of to reconstruct the gristmill and miller's cottagemostly due to the fact that the pressures of Restriction and the Clinical depression didn't encourage the restoring of the distillery.
By 2007, the distillery was open to the public. The rebuilt distillery is more than a static homage to Washington's business-savvy: it's a fully-functioning distillery in its own. Annually, Steve Bashore, supervisor of historic professions at Mount Vernon, leads a little group in distilling scotch precisely as Anderson and others carried out in the original distillery.

On the third day of the process, yeast is added, which eats the sugars and transforms them right into alcohol. After that, the mash is put right into the copper stills (which we recreated from a surviving 18th-century still shown in the distillery's museum, on the structure's second floor), where it is heated up by a wood fire.
As the alcohol vapor cools down, it condenses back to liquid, which drains of the barrel right into a container. To see how whiskey is made at Mount Vernon, look into the video listed below. In Washington's day, this scotch would be marketed clear and unagedbut today (because there's a market for it), Bashore and Mount Vernon will certainly mature some of the whiskey that they distill.
